Created in 2009, Blue Line Sterilization Services has been concentrated to reducing the time to market for innovators innovating new medical devices. The company specializes by maintaining a bank of 8 cubic foot ethylene oxide (EO) sterilizers, providing FDA and EU compliant sterilization with turnaround times between 1 to 3 days—an achievement unreachable with larger EO sterilization services.

Co-founders Brant and Jane Gard identified the significant need for accelerated sterilization options, particularly for active development programs producing innovative medical devices. The ability to swiftly navigate through device iterations is critical in reducing the need for additional funding, preserving the value of investors' equity, and expediting time to market. Faster service and reduced time to market hold valuable value for employees, investors, and the patients benefiting from improved medical care.

Beyond routine sterilization, Blue Line offers rapid turnkey validations and small batch releases that support clinical trials and FDA/CE submissions. Collaborating with Blue Line enables developers of new medical devices to considerably shorten their schedules, swiftly assess new design iterations, and expedite product launches.

Why Medical Device Sterilization Matters

Infection prevention remains a fundamental pillar of modern medicine.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) estimate that around 1 in 31 hospital patients experiences at least one healthcare-associated infection (HAI). Thorough sterilization of medical devices significantly reduces the risk of these infections, safeguarding patients and healthcare providers simultaneously. Insufficient sterilization can bring about outbreaks of serious diseases like hepatitis, HIV, and antibiotic-resistant bacterial infections.

Methods Used in Medical Device Sterilization

The science behind sterilization has progressed substantially over the last century, utilizing a variety of methods suited to distinct types of devices and materials. Some of the most widely used techniques include:

Autoclave Steam Sterilization

Autoclaving remains the most popular and trusted method of sterilization, particularly suitable for surgical instruments and reusable metal devices. Using high-pressure saturated steam at temperatures around 121–134°C, autoclaving effectively kills bacteria, viruses, fungi, and spores. This method is quick, economical, and green, although not suitable for heat-sensitive materials.

Innovative Advancements in Medical Instrument Sterilization

As the field matures, several key trends are steering medical sterilization methods:

Environmentally Friendly Sterilization

As environmental compliance rules intensify, companies are rapidly embracing sustainable sterilization methods. Steps include decreasing reliance on hazardous chemicals like ethylene oxide, exploring environmentally safe packaging alternatives, and optimizing resource use in sterilization processes.

Sophisticated Materials and Device Complexity

The expansion of complex medical devices—such as robotic surgery instruments and intricate diagnostic equipment—demands sterilization systems capable of handling complex materials. Progress in sterilization include methods particularly low-temperature plasma sterilization and hydrogen peroxide vapor, which can sterilize without damaging delicate components.

Automated Sterilization Tracking

With advances in digital technology, traceability of sterilization operations is now more precise than ever. Digital traceability systems offer exhaustive documentation, automated compliance checks, and real-time notifications, significantly cutting down human error and increasing patient safety.
